Main Responsibilities
- Supports Facilities Manager with overseeing quality services in building management
- Coordinates the company’s vehicles fleet management and procedures
- Keeps daily contact with drivers to ensure the smoothly execution of fleet operations and communications
- Interacts with leasing companies and vehicle importers regarding car models, fleet policy updates, and day-to-day operations
- Coordinates fleet’s operations, including parking space allocation, vehicle database management
- Conducts service reviews, while takes on the services’ contract negotiations and management
- Supports the evaluation of vendor offers, contributing to the effectiveness of day-to-day operations
- Assists in ensuring compliance with Safety and Environmental requirements
- Supports the Facilities Department in managing CAPEX, purchase orders and accruals related to the HR department
- Handles cost center allocation, budgeting management and quarterly financial reporting, including accident and cost metrics, fuel consumption, and vehicle allocation
- Prepares and creates annual purchase orders, while handles car fines
- Evaluates and manages offers, generates reports for the Fleet Safety Committee, and handle invoice approvals
